We are part of New Face of the Third Age, a movement aimed at showing how the elderly are increasingly active these days.
And the creation of a new pictogram to represent seniors in Brazil is the first step towards this goal. We are looking to replace the current symbol, which is a person bent over, with a cane.
Life expectancy in Brazil is increasing by an average of four years each decade.
This population is now comprised of more than 22 million people over 60, and that number is growing at a vertiginous pace. Are they millions of pitiful, invalid oldies?
No. And they cannot be seen way. Without the vitality of these people, our society itself would collapse.
What if all these people surrendered to the stereotype that stigmatizes them - frail and weakened human beings - instead of keeping active? Who would foot the bill?
Does it make any sense? You, who will be 60 someday, would like to be portrayed that way in the future?
